Troubleshooting When Using the Facsimile Function Message Check whether there are any network problems. {14-09} 3 Check whether there are any network problems. {14-33} Check whether there are any network problems. {15-01} 34 Cause Solution E-mail transmission was refused • Check that the machine e-mail by SMTP authentication, POP be- address is correctly pro- fore SMTP authentication or grammed from File Transfer login authentication of the com- under System Settings. See puter in which the folder for "File Transfer", General Set- transfer is specified. tings Guide. You can also use the Web Image Monitor for confirmation. See the Web Im- age Monitor's Help. • Check that the user name and password of the E-mail Account are correctly programmed from File Transfer under System Settings. See "File Transfer", General Settings Guide. You can also use the Web Image Monitor for confirmation. See the Web Image Monitor's Help. • Check that the user ID and password for the computer in which the folder for forwarding is specified are correctly programmed. • Check that the folder for forwarding is correctly specified. • Check that the computer in which the folder for forwarding is specified is correctly operated. • Consult the administrator. No machine's e-mail address is programmed. • Check that the e-mail address of mail account is correctly programmed using "File Transfer" of "System Settings". See "File Transfer", General Settings Guide. You can also use the Web Image Monitor for confirmation. See the Web Image Monitor's Help. • Consult the administrator. No POP3/IMAP4 server address • Check that the host name or is programmed. IPv4 address of the POP3/IMAP4 server is cor- rectly programmed using the Web Image Monitor. See the Web Image Monitor's Help. • Consult the administrator.
